UK— Product testing organisation Which? has picked Verve to replace Lightspeed Research as manager of its survey panel following a four-way pitch.
The panel, comprised of 30,000 Which? magazine subscribers, is to be overhauled from a primarily quantitative survey platform to a Web 2.0 community, newly renamed Which? Connect.
“As the UK’s leading consumer champion, it is essential for Which? to be engaged with its members,” said head of insight Harry Mirpuri. “Which? Connect will provide us with the platform to run a wide range of quantitative and qualitative activities with community members, and stimulate some lively discussions.”
